Porto came from behind to beat Braga 2-1 at Estádio Municipal de Braga, a result that keeps the leaders on top of Liga Portugal.

After the restart, Rodrigo Zalazar converted a penalty in the 54th minute to put Braga ahead.

Lukas Hornicek then saved smartly from Victor Froholdt (58.) as Porto pushed for a response.

The visitors' bench made the difference. William levelled from Oskar Pietuszewski's pass (69.). Seko Fofana, also on as a substitute, rifled in after a corner to complete the turnaround (80.).

The spot kick was awarded for a foul by Gabri Veiga on Sikou Niakate at a corner.

Six minutes were indicated for added time, and Porto managed the closing stages with control.

Braga saw more of the ball at 61.7% but registered only one effort on target. Porto attempted 12 shots, three on target.

Next, Braga visit Moreirense. Porto host Famalicão.
